Pillow block bearings are mounted units that combine a bearing insert with a bolt-down cast housing, making them easy to install on conveyors and shafts.

What Gets the Best Price for Pillow Block Bearings
For pillow block bearings specifically, Little Rock sellers get the best offers on new-in-box units with intact seals and original packaging. Dodge and Rexnord mounted units hold value well; complete housing-plus-insert assemblies in good condition sell quickly. Even used pillow block bearings in serviceable condition are worth recovering — we assess wear, corrosion, and remaining service life on every lot before quoting.
